Technology Wages Near Butte

OccupationMedian Annual Wage (Montana, statewide)
Software Developer$100,190
Information Security Analyst$87,100
Computer Network Architect$101,240
Network and Computer Systems Administrator$77,840
Computer Network Support Specialist$57,500
Computer User Support Specialist$53,410
Web Developer$65,490
Computer and Information Systems ManagerN/A

Source: BLS, May 2024 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.

How do I verify a program is accredited?

Confirm institutional accreditation via the U.S. Department of Education database (U.S. Dept. of Education database), and check for any program-specific accreditation listed by the school.
